Solution for 2(x+4)-3=3(x+2)-2 equation:


Simplifying
2(x + 4) + -3 = 3(x + 2) + -2

Reorder the terms:
2(4 + x) + -3 = 3(x + 2) + -2
(4 * 2 + x * 2) + -3 = 3(x + 2) + -2
(8 + 2x) + -3 = 3(x + 2) + -2

Reorder the terms:
8 + -3 + 2x = 3(x + 2) + -2

Combine like terms: 8 + -3 = 5
5 + 2x = 3(x + 2) + -2

Reorder the terms:
5 + 2x = 3(2 + x) + -2
5 + 2x = (2 * 3 + x * 3) + -2
5 + 2x = (6 + 3x) + -2

Reorder the terms:
5 + 2x = 6 + -2 + 3x

Combine like terms: 6 + -2 = 4
5 + 2x = 4 + 3x

Solving
5 + 2x = 4 + 3x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3x' to each side of the equation.
5 + 2x + -3x = 4 + 3x + -3x

Combine like terms: 2x + -3x = -1x
5 + -1x = 4 + 3x + -3x

Combine like terms: 3x + -3x = 0
5 + -1x = 4 + 0
5 + -1x = 4

Add '-5' to each side of the equation.
5 + -5 + -1x = 4 + -5

Combine like terms: 5 + -5 = 0
0 + -1x = 4 + -5
-1x = 4 + -5

Combine like terms: 4 + -5 = -1
-1x = -1

Divide each side by '-1'.
x = 1

Simplifying
x = 1
